How would you plot (-9, 2)? Please include where you start and which direction do you move next and how much.

You would go on the x line and find where the negative numbers are first (since there is a NEGATIVE 9). The left side is the negative side. From there, you find number 9 (but don’t plot anything get, just remember where it is). Then you go up 2 (so find where the 2 is in y and go up that many). You don’t directly go over to the Y line.

You go left 9 and up 2. You then plot your point at that coordinate.
